These models reproduce the surface density of emitters inferred from recent observations, and also agree with previous non–detections. Although a detailed determination of the individual model parameters is precluded by uncertainties, we find that (i) the dust content of primordial galaxies builds up in no more than ∼ 5 × 10^8 yr, (ii) the galactic HII regions are nhomogeneous with a cloud covering factor of order unity, and (iii) the overall star formation efficiency is at least ∼ 5%. Future observations should be able to detect Lyα galaxies upto redshifts of z ∼ 8. If\r\nthe universe is reionized at zr ∼< 8, the corresponding decline in the number of Lyα\r\nemitters at z ∼> zr could prove to be a useful probe of the reionization epoch.\r\n","lang":"eng"}],"date_created":"2025-01-03T12:37:12Z","day":"27","OA_type":"green","citation":{"mla":"Haiman, Zoltán, and M.
